WebThis enzyme also removes phosphate groups from proteins. FastAP is a novel alkaline phosphatase, which is active in all Thermo Scientific restriction enzyme buffers as well as in PCR buffers. It dephosphorylates all types of DNA ends (blunt, 5'- and 3'-overhangs) in 10 minutes at 37°C. The enzyme is inactivated in 5 minutes at 75°C ( see ... M0201L T4 PNK catalyzes the transfer and exchange of P from the gamma; position of ATP to the 5 -hydroxyl terminus of polynucleotides (double-and single-stranded DNA and RNA) and nucleoside 3-monophosphates.
